The Orvane Labs bike cage and the east and west parking gates operate on separate access schedules, and facilities desk staff should note that visitor vehicles may only use the west gate between 07:00 and 19:00. Cyclists requesting cage access must show a valid day pass, and their details should be entered in the access ledger before the cage is opened. Gates must never be propped open, even briefly, during deliveries. When a manual override is required at either gate, use the code below.

staff pass of fadup-fawig = bdg-FUNKS-4

TURN-208: Gatevale turnstile counters at the Merrow Field pilot double-count when a rotation reverses mid-cycle. Attendance totals drift roughly 2% high per event. The debounce window fix is implemented, reviewed by Ilsa, and soak-tested across two simulated match days without drift. Ready for your cut; the candidate build is identified below.

trace token, tagag-tafog: htk6_5ed18c

## Formula sandbox tuning

User-supplied formulas in Gridmoor execute inside a restricted interpreter with hard ceilings on time, memory, and call depth. Reviewers should confirm any change to these ceilings is justified in the PR description, since raising them widens the abuse surface. Defaults were chosen from production traces. The current limits are as follows.

limits module of tafog-fawip:
WEIGHTS = {
    "julix": 57,
    "lamys": 992,
    "kasvan": 209,
    "quenok": 750,
    "alddor": 259,
    "oliath": 1009,
    "wenix": 815,
}

CI troubleshooting — CSV import wizard (Heronfall project). The wizard's integration stage fails when the Quarrow test runner seeds fixtures with Windows line endings; the delimiter sniffer then misreads headers and the whole suite reds out. On-call: normalize fixture line endings in the pre-step, rerun the stage, and confirm the sniffer log shows comma detection. Verify the rerun used the build carrying this token.

build token for kagaf-hahof: htk14_9d3d4d26d7d8de